There is a serious vulnerability occurring on Steam accounts. Many people are being partially hacked/scammed, with scammers infiltrating their accounts and selling the items the person has in their inventory, whether it's from CS 2, Dota 2, Rust, TF2, etc. Most of the time, they simply steal cases from these games without need Steam Guard confirmation, or sometimes manage to steal any item in general or they also use Steam Wallet to buy items, thereby accumulating funds in their Steam accounts, I would like you and the entire Valve team to improve its security and add more options to reinforce protection, such as requiring Steam Guard confirmation to sell everything on the Steam market or trade something from a person's inventory, regardless of the item values.
Additionally, a system security for API keys should be implemented because many are being hacked via API.
Please enhance Steam Guard and add stronger security options to protect accounts. thanks.
